Trump open to extending Chevron's license to produce oil in Venezuela, WSJ reports
Portfolio Pulse from
President Trump is considering extending Chevron's license to produce oil in Venezuela, which was initially set to expire on April 3. This decision could impact Chevron's operations and its stock price.
